Unequally yoked

The Bible says... "do not be unequally yoked"...

This is not a "rule" to keep us from having fun... it is meant to make life better.  I was recently asked if I would ever consider marrying someone with beliefs that differ from mine.  This got me thinking...

I want to come along side and serve God with my husband.  That is difficult to do when there is not agreement in who you believe God is.

I want to lift up my husband and support him as he follows where the Lord is leading him.  It is difficult enough for me to trust that God is in control at times so if I knew we believed God to have different attributes, this would make marriage more difficult.

I want to be with my husband as a united front when raising our children.  This is also very difficult to do with two people who were raised very differently not to mention when the guidelines of raising children from two faiths differ.

The creator of the universe doesn't put rules or regulations on us to limit our fun but to protect and give us His best!  He is a good Father that wants what is best for his children.  He is also a gentleman that allows us to make our own choices and live with the consequences.
